Why Glennville Homes Experience Drain Problems

Georgia's red clay soil is notoriously aggressive on underground pipes. When dry, clay soil shrinks and shifts, creating micro-fractures in aging sewer lines. When saturated by heavy Georgia summer rains, it expands and puts crushing pressure on pipe joints. This cycle of expansion and contraction — repeated year after year — is why homes across Tattnall County experience recurring drain and sewer line problems.

The most common drain issues we diagnose and resolve in Glennville include:

  • Kitchen drain clogs — Grease and food debris that builds up over years of cooking, especially fats from Southern cooking staples like bacon, fried chicken, and butter-based dishes common in Georgia kitchens.
  • Bathroom drain blockages — Hair, soap scum, and personal care product residue accumulating in shower and bathroom sink drains over time.
  • Main sewer line blockages — Tree root intrusion is the leading cause of main line problems throughout Tattnall County, especially in neighborhoods with mature trees near property lines.
  • Slow drains — Partial blockages that haven't completely stopped flow but are worsening. Best addressed before they become complete backups.
  • Recurring clogs — If your drain clogs repeatedly in the same spot, it often indicates grease coating on pipe walls, a partial pipe issue, or persistent root intrusion requiring more than a standard snake.

Do I need hydro jetting or will snaking work?
For most Glennville homes with standard clogs from hair and soap, mechanical snaking is the most cost-effective solution. However, if you have tree root intrusion, mineral deposits, or recurring clogs typical of older Tattnall County homes, hydro jetting is more effective and prevents future blockages for longer periods. We can assess your drain during an initial inspection and recommend the best option for your situation.

Tips to Prevent Drain Clogs in Glennville Homes

Glennville homes face unique drainage challenges due to Tattnall County's dense red clay soil, established neighborhoods with invasive tree roots, and Georgia's humid climate that accelerates grease buildup in kitchen drains. Understanding these local conditions is essential for preventing costly clogs and maintaining healthy plumbing systems throughout your home.

  • Install Drain Screens and Strainers — Use fine mesh screens in all sinks and shower drains to catch hair, food particles, and debris before they enter your pipes. In Glennville's older residential areas, this simple preventative step reduces the likelihood of a clogged drain Glennville homeowners commonly experience.
  • Manage Grease Buildup Properly — Never pour cooking grease down kitchen drains; instead, collect it in a container and dispose of it in the trash. Georgia's humidity accelerates bacterial growth in grease deposits, making drain cleaning Glennville services more necessary without proper prevention habits.
  • Address Tree Root Intrusion Early — Pine and oak trees common throughout established Glennville neighborhoods can infiltrate sewer lines through small cracks. Consider hydro jetting Glennville services annually if you suspect root damage, and trim trees away from your sewer line to prevent future problems.
  • Flush Drains Regularly with Hot Water — Weekly hot water flushes help clear minor buildup in your pipes and are especially important in Glennville where clay soil settles around foundations. This maintenance reduces the need for emergency drain clog Glennville repairs during peak seasons.
  • Schedule Professional Inspections Before Seasonal Changes — Have a plumber in Glennville inspect your sewer line before fall and spring when root growth peaks and heavy rains increase ground moisture. Preventative camera inspections catch problems early and save significant repair costs.
